Before embarking on a long ride, perform a thorough pre-trip inspection. This step helps identify any issues that could cause problems on the road. Check for loose bolts, leaks, and any signs of wear and tear. Pay special attention to the frame, ensuring no cracks or dents could compromise the bike's integrity. Verify that the wheels are in good condition with tight spokes and genuine rims. Additionally, inspect the cables for fraying or stretching and ensure all lights function correctly. Tires play a critical role in your bike's performance and safety. Before your trip, check and maintain the recommended tyre pressure, as under-inflated or over-inflated tyres can affect handling and fuel efficiency. Inspect the tread depth to ensure adequate grip, and replace tyres if they show excessive wear. Additionally, check for any punctures or embedded objects that could cause a flat tyre. Proper tyre maintenance enhances your bike's performance and ensures a safer ride, reducing the risk of accidents caused by tyre failure.
Sustaining the proper fluid levels is essential to your bike's efficient functioning. Check the engine oil level frequently and add more if needed. If necessary, change the oil before your journey. Make sure the coolant level is sufficient to avoid engine overheating. You should also confirm that the brake fluid levels are acceptable. Maintaining your bike's fluids properly keeps it operating smoothly and guards against mechanical problems that could ruin your ride.
Effective braking is essential for safety, especially on lengthy trips. Check for wear on the brake pads and replace them if needed. Ensure there are no leaks or breaks in the brake lines and look for wear or corrosion on the braking discs or drums. Maintaining your brakes regularly ensures they work correctly, giving you dependable stopping power and improving your overall road safety.
A properly maintained chain is necessary for efficient power transfer. To prevent rust and wear, the chain should be regularly cleaned and lubricated. The chain tension should be adjusted according to the manufacturer's recommendations to guarantee optimum performance. The gears should be examined for wear and replaced if they show signs of damage. Proper chain and gear maintenance also increases the longevity of these essential parts.
Examining the electrical system before your travel is essential because a failing one could leave you stuck. Ensure the terminals are safe and clean and the battery is charged correctly. Ensure all lights, such as the indicators, taillights, and headlights, are operating as intended. Furthermore, give the horn a test to ensure it is operating correctly. A dependable electrical system makes riding safer, and it allows you to see and communicate better on the road.
Good suspension and steering are vital for comfort and control. Check for leaks or damage in the front forks and rear shocks, and adjust the suspension settings according to your load. Ensure there is no play or tightness in the steering head bearings. Properly maintained suspension and steering systems provide better handling and a smoother ride, reducing fatigue during long journeys. An emergency kit is crucial, especially for long-ride bikes, where the journey may take you far from help. Keep essential tools on you, such as wrenches and screwdrivers. Your kit should also have extra bulbs, fuses, and a tyre repair kit. A simple first-aid pack can also assist in treating minor wounds. By being ready for anything unexpected, you can minimise travel disruptions by managing little repairs and issues while driving.

How To Maintain Your Two Wheeler In The Rainy Season?
During the monsoon, the weather is pleasant and everything around you is green and looks fresh. However, if you are a biker, then monsoons bring with it a myriad of problems. You need to be extra careful as you have to make your way through potholes and ride on slippery roads. Yes, you need to take extra care to maintain your bike during the rainy season. So, here we are with some bike maintenance tips that will help your two-wheeler brave the rainy season.
How To Maintain Your Two Wheeler In The Rainy Season?
Here are four simple tips to maintain your bike during the rainy season
Get an anti-rust protection layer applied
While the monsoon brings much-needed respite from the hot weather, the moisture in the air can cause potential damage to the parts of your two-wheeler. Damp climatic conditions can cause certain parts of the bike to rust. If this is not taken care of, rusting can cause the parts to disintegrate. The best way to protect your bike from rust damage is to ensure that the chain and battery terminals are well-lubricated. A basic motorcycle maintenance tip to prevent rust formation is to apply petroleum jelly on the rubber oil seals.
Choose covered parking spots
During monsoon, it’s advisable not to park your two-wheeler in the open. Unlike four-wheelers, rainwater can get inside your bike and cause damage to the electrical components, making your bike prone to long-term issues like rusting and electrical failures. So the easiest of all motorbike maintenance tips is to park your bike under a shed. If you are not able to find a shed, then use a waterproof bike body cover to protect it from rain. Also, never park your bike under a tree during monsoon as heavy rain may cause a branch or the tree itself to fall on your two-wheeler and damage it.
Have the tyres checked
Yet another basic bike maintenance tip for monsoon is to get the tyres checked regularly. Getting tyres checked is critical because the roads tend to be extra slippery during the monsoons. As such, it is very important to keep your tyres in good condition. Make sure the rubber has not worn out and do not wait to change the tyres until they are completely worn out. Old and damaged tyres can increase the risk of accidents and other related incidents leading to vehicle damage.
Service the brakes
The list of bike maintenance tips in rainy season also includes getting the brakes serviced. Continuous exposure to rainwater can cause the brake pads to get jammed. Before the start of the monsoon, it’s best to have a professional take a look at the brakes and make sure they are functioning well. Also, when you are riding your bike during the rain, maintain a good distance from other vehicles and apply brakes gradually. Applying brakes suddenly on wet roads can cause the bike to skid.

5 Fabulous FASTag Benefits for Motorists
FASTag, from the National Highways Authority of India, is a sticker that is affixed on the windscreen of a vehicle. This sticker uses Radio Frequency Identification RFID Technology to deduct toll payments from the wallet linked with the FASTag account. A FASTag is valid for a period of five years. You are probably aware by now that FASTag is mandatory for all category ‘M’ and ‘N’ vehicles in the country. These categories include four–wheelers that transport passengers and/or goods. You may wonder whether there are any benefits of FASTag for vehicle owners. The answer is a definite YES. Let’s take a look at 5 real FASTag benefits for motorists in the country.
1. Eliminates the need for a cash transactionOne of the main advantages of FASTag is that it eliminates the need for cash transactions at toll plazas. Cash transactions are one of the major reasons for traffic jams at toll booths. Now, motorists can enjoy a hassle–free experience as they zip through toll plazas without needing to shuffle around for change wile making payments.
The removal of the need for cash transactions has another important advantage. Due to the pandemic, we all prefer to have a contactless experience and now with FASTag, you can pay toll fees without exchanging physical notes and coins.
2. Reduces wait timesLong queues at toll booths will soon be a thing of the past as FASTag lets you sail through without having to endure an extended waiting time. This helps save time and fuel that would have otherwise been wasted in a frustrating wait in queue.
3. Easy recharge methodsYour FASTag can be easily recharged online in a matter of minutes (or less). You can easily load the amount you need from your credit card or debit card or even use net banking.
4. Easy tracking of toll expensesIf you need to keep track of FASTag expenses for reimbursement purposes, then you will love FASTag. Each time you pay a toll tax, you receive an email and SMS message. You can use these to understand what your expenses have been on your commutes. Now, you don’t have to manually note down each toll fee.
5. Paperless and environment friendlyFASTag is also extremely environment friendly, an important feature in these times when we all need to reduce our carbon footprint. When there are no queues at toll plazas, there will automatically be a lower consumption of fuel. Plus, the automatic deduction of the fee from the account linked eliminates the need for a paper receipt given for cash transactions.

1. Long-term Insurance for Two-WheelerOne of the most convenient features of two-wheeler insurance is the option for long-term coverage. Instead of renewing your bike insurance policy annually, you can opt for a long term two wheeler insurance plan that covers your vehicle for two or three years. This saves you the hassle of yearly renewals and ensures continuous coverage, reducing the risk of policy lapses. Additionally, long-term policies often come with discounts on premiums and better no-claim bonuses, making them a cost-effective choice for many riders.
2. Safety for Pillion RidersA comprehensive two-wheeler insurance policy can also extend its protection to pillion riders. With the right add-ons, you can include personal accident cover for your pillion rider. In the unfortunate event of an accident, the insurance will cover medical expenses, hospital charges, and even compensation for permanent disabilities or loss of life. Ensuring the safety of your pillion rider is crucial, and this feature provides an added layer of security for your loved ones.

Tips to Reduce Your Car Insurance:One of the simplest yet most effective ways to reduce car insurance costs is by minimizing your car use. Many insurance companies offer usage-based insurance policies, where premiums are determined based on the actual distance you cover and the frequency of your drives.
By reducing unnecessary trips and going for public transportation or carpooling when possible, you can lower your insurance costs.
It's not just about your own safety, following traffic rules can also save you money on your car insurance. Insurers often consider your driving record when calculating premiums, and a history of traffic violations can lead to higher rates. Having a low record of traffic violations can give a sense of guarantee to the insurer hence leading to low premiums.
You should drive responsibly, obey speed limits, and avoid reckless behaviour so that you can demonstrate to insurers that you're a low-risk driver, which can lead to lower premiums.
Investing in personal accident cover as part of your car insurance policy can provide an added layer of protection for you and your passengers in the event of an accident.
While this may increase your initial premium slightly, it can offer invaluable financial support in case of injuries, medical expenses, or even loss of income due to disability resulting from an accident.
Your driving habits can have a direct impact on your car insurance premiums. Insurance companies often use telematics devices to monitor driving behaviour, including acceleration, braking, and cornering.
Adopt safe driving practices such as maintaining a steady speed, avoiding sudden stops, and following traffic guidelines so that insurers know that your chances of getting into an accident are low, which in turn can result in lower premium costs.
While proper car insurance typically covers damages caused by accidents, it's also important to safeguard your vehicle against theft. Adding anti-theft devices such as steering wheel locks, GPS trackers, or immobilizers to your car can not only deter thieves but also lower your insurance premiums.
Insurers often offer discounts for vehicles equipped with anti-theft measures, as they pose a lower risk of theft-related claims.
